AUBURN – Auburn Firefighters Local 797 honored the heroes of the attack on the World Trade Center on Sept. 11.
Platoon Chief Ray Levesque donated an American flag listing all the firefighters and police officers who died in the line of duty on that day.
Lt. Al Murch created a glassed-in case for the flag, which is now on display at Central Fire Headquarters.
Prior to the ceremony, L’Heureux, along with Pvts. Jim Hart and Brendon Joyce, took part in a memorial at Sherwood Heights School where all students and teachers participated. There was a gathering around the American flag where all in attendance sang patriotic songs.
